Types of Dewalt Drills Suitable for Concrete Drilling

Dewalt offers a range of drills that are suitable for concrete drilling, including rotary hammers, hammer drills, and right-angle drills. Rotary hammers are the most powerful and are designed for heavy-duty drilling and demolition work. They use a combination of rotation and hammering action to drill through concrete and other masonry materials.

Hammer drills are similar to rotary hammers but are less powerful and are designed for lighter drilling tasks. They are still capable of drilling through concrete, but may not be as efficient as rotary hammers. Right-angle drills, on the other hand, are designed for drilling in tight spaces and are ideal for applications where a traditional drill cannot be used.

Each type of drill has its own unique features and benefits, and the choice of which one to use will depend on the specific application and requirements. For example, a rotary hammer may be the best choice for drilling through thick concrete, while a hammer drill may be sufficient for drilling through thinner concrete or brick.

In addition to these types of drills, Dewalt also offers a range of drill bits and accessories that are specifically designed for concrete drilling. These include carbide-tipped bits, diamond-coated bits, and core bits, each with its own unique characteristics and benefits.

Power and Speed

The power and speed of a drill are essential factors to consider when drilling through concrete. A drill with high power and speed will be able to handle tough concrete with ease, while a drill with low power and speed may struggle. When looking for a drill, consider the amount of torque and RPM (revolutions per minute) it offers. A higher torque and RPM will result in faster and more efficient drilling. It’s also important to consider the type of motor used in the drill, with brushless motors being more efficient and reliable than brushed motors.

The power and speed of a drill will also depend on the type of battery it uses. Cordless drills are convenient and offer more portability, but they may not offer the same level of power as corded drills. When choosing a cordless drill, consider the voltage and ampere-hour (Ah) rating of the battery. A higher voltage and Ah rating will result in more power and longer battery life. Look for drills with high-capacity batteries and fast charging systems to minimize downtime and maximize productivity.

What is the difference between a Dewalt hammer drill and a rotary hammer?

A Dewalt hammer drill and a rotary hammer are both power tools used for drilling and driving, but they have some key differences. A hammer drill is a type of drill that uses a hammering action to help drill through tough materials like concrete. It is typically used for drilling holes and driving screws. A rotary hammer, on the other hand, is a more heavy-duty tool that uses a combination of rotation and hammering action to break up and remove material.

A rotary hammer is typically used for more demanding tasks, such as breaking up concrete or removing tile. It is also often used for drilling large holes or driving large screws. In general, a rotary hammer is more powerful and versatile than a hammer drill, but it is also typically more expensive and heavier. When deciding between a hammer drill and a rotary hammer, you should consider the specific tasks you will be using the tool for and choose the one that best meets your needs.

What are the safety precautions I should take when using a Dewalt drill for concrete?

When using a Dewalt drill for concrete, there are several safety precautions you should take. First and foremost, you should always wear protective gear, such as safety glasses, gloves, and a dust mask. This will help to protect you from flying debris and dust. You should also make sure to keep loose clothing and long hair tied back, and avoid wearing jewelry that could get caught in the drill.

Additionally, you should always use the correct bits and accessories for the task at hand, and make sure that they are properly secured in the drill. You should also avoid overreaching or stretching while using the drill, and make sure to keep your work area clean and clear of clutter. It’s also important to follow the manufacturer’s instructions and guidelines, and to take regular breaks to avoid fatigue. By taking these precautions, you can help to ensure a safe and successful drilling experience.
